* Start September 2019 *GRADUATE TEACHING ASSISTANT Hounslow Veritas are currently working with an all boys secondary school based in Hounslow. The school are looking for a dedicated graduate Teaching assistant to be a positive influence & role model for these young male students. The candidate will join a large & supportive SEN department within the mainstream school. The school are particularly interested in meeting candidates that have a keen interest in pursuing a career in teaching. The role will involve supporting KS3 and KS4 students in small groups, the candidate will also be appointed a key student to support 1:1 throughout the year.The candidate will be supporting SEN students with ASD, Dyslexia and also learning and communication difficulties, therefore, an understanding of SEN and an empathetic nature is essential. You will be responsible for improving social skills and also monitoring behaviour. Behaviour management skills are desirable.
